Victorian Premier Daniel Andrews taken to hospital after fall

Victorian Premier Daniel Andrews has gone to hospital after falling over while getting ready this morning.
His office told the ABC that Mr Andrews did not have head injuries, but said the fall was “concerning”.
A spokesperson said he had gone to hospital for x-rays, as a precaution.
Deputy Premier James Merlino will take over Mr Andrews’s duties today, including at a 9:30am press conference north-east of Melbourne.
